Mini's First Time (2006)

20061h 31mRComedyCrimeDrama

Desperate to be free from her drunken, unloving mother Diane, the beautiful, scheming young Mini seduces her stepfather Martin and soon convinces him to join her in a sadistic scheme to have Diane declared insane. But their conspiracy soon escalates to murder and when John Garson, a young detective starts investigating, Martin and Mini begin to turn on each other.

What people think about Mini's First Time

Mini’s First Time is the kind of wicked little noir-comedy that dares you to laugh even as it tightens the screws, powered by a trio of performances that are far better than this sort of trashy premise has any right to deserve. Nikki Reed plays Mini with a cool, calculating charm, while Alec Baldwin and Carrie-Anne Moss bring just enough bruised humanity to keep the satire from floating off into pure cartoon. The vibe is glossy, cynical, and deliciously mean-spirited, taking aim at opportunism and family dysfunction with a grin that’s sharp enough to draw blood. It’s not for viewers who need sympathetic characters or moral comfort, but if you enjoy dark humor, twisty gamesmanship, and actors clearly relishing the bad behavior, it’s an entertaining descent.
